Suspension and Steering

Not only is the newest Camaro muscular, but it is also agile. An independent rear suspension and variable-ratio power steering combine for a nimble and quick-handling Camaro.  Additionally, a weight differential that loads 52% of the weight over the front of the vehicle gives this muscle car top-end handling characteristics.

Performance and Efficiency

In addition to a suspension and handling system that makes even the most mundane drives fun and exciting, the engine on the newest Camaro is ready to make hearts pound at the drop of a pedal. The 323hp, V-6 engine catapults the muscle car up to speed quickly and burns fuel surprisingly efficiently; this impressive vessel offers up to 30mpg on the highway. If you crave power above all else form your Camaro, then the special SS, 6.2 liter, V-8 engine, which generates 426hp and 420 ft.-lbs. of torque, is right for you.

Technologically Advanced

Chevrolet has done a lot to put their company at the forefront of the automotive technology market.  The new Camaro boasts a variety of high-tech features, like remote-start, Bluetooth compatibility, and mobile-apps for vehicle monitoring and roadside assistance. The Camaro is no longer an unrefined muscle car, it sports performance and luxury.
